
"PITTSBURGH -- Amid prolonged contract talks with the Pittsburgh Steelers, defensive captain and four-time All-Pro defensive lineman Cameron Heyward said Friday he's "preparing" when asked if he was going to play vs. the New York Jets on Sunday. However, Heyward didn't commit to being on the field for the team's season opener. "I'm preparing," he said. "Still got some time, but we'll see." Asked if his playing status hinged on the completion of a reworked contract, Heyward was vague."
""I wish I had a straight answer for you right now," he said. "All I can tell you is I've had to have a lot of tough conversations with my family." Heyward was equally vague about his level of optimism that the contract situation would be resolved by Sunday. "I wish I could be more optimistic, but [I] just try and stay in the moment," he said. "I don't have all the answers so it's more of me just waiting and seeing what can happen.""
